Conduct a Home Assessment
The first thing you should do to get your home ready is to take a look at it right now. Take a look at your home from the point of view of a first home buyer to start.
Find Repairs: Fix any problems that you can see, like taps that leak, doors that squeak, or tiles that are cracked. Small fixes can have a big effect on how buyers feel about your home.
Plan your changes: Think about upgrades that won’t break the bank, like replacing old fixtures or painting the walls a neutral color. People in Minneapolis are more likely to buy homes that have modern touches.
Inspection before listing: Hiring a professional home tester can help you find problems with your home before buyers do. This way, you can fix the problems before they become a problem.
Boost Your Curb Appeal
When people come to look at your house for the first time, first impressions are very important. The outside of your house should look nice and be well taken care of.
It’s time to trim the bushes, mow the yard, and add some flowers that bloom at the right time to your garden. During the winter, clear snow and ice off of your paths to make your house look warm and inviting.
Maintenance for the outside of your home: Power wash the walls, clean the gutters, and make sure the roof is in good shape. In Minneapolis, buyers often look for homes with well-kept exteriors, especially when the weather is bad.
Stage Your Home for Success
Staging your home can help buyers picture themselves living there, which can help you sell it faster.
Declutter and depersonalize: To make rooms feel open and neutral, get rid of personal things, extra furniture, and clutter. People in Minneapolis like to buy clean, open areas.
Attention to Key Areas: Draw attention to places like the kitchen, living room, and master bedroom that get a lot of use. A well-staged kitchen can make all the difference in how quickly you sell your home.
Adding the finishing touches: To make a room feel warm and welcoming, use soft lighting, fresh flowers, and cozy touches.

Step 2: Setting the Right Price
Price is very important when Selling your house fast in Minneapolis, MN. A home that is placed correctly gets more buyers, stays on the market for less time, and often has multiple offers. How to choose the right price:
Understand the Minneapolis Market
Find out about the most recent home sales in your area. Check out similar homes in terms of size, condition, and location to get an idea of how much people are ready to pay. When it comes to Minneapolis, homes that are priced right sell faster, especially in areas like Uptown and Northeast that people want to live in.
Get a Comparative Market Analysis (CMA)
Work with a real estate agent to make a CMA. Your home will be compared to recently sold homes in this report, which will help you set a price that will get you a quick sale while still being competitive.
Consider Pricing Strategies
Market Value Pricing: Set the price at the fair market value to get serious buyers.
Slightly Below Market Value: Get people interested quickly and get more than one deal.
Testing the Market: If your home has special features, you might set the price a little higher, but be ready to make changes quickly if you need to.
Factor in Timing
Seasonal changes can be seen in Minneapolis real estate. When demand is high, like in the spring and early summer, homes sell faster. During these times, setting prices that are competitive can speed up the process.
Stay Flexible
Keep an eye on buyer comments and interest. If people aren’t showing or making offers on your house, you might need to change the price.

Step 3: Choosing a Selling Strategy
If you want to sell your house quickly in Minneapolis, Minnesota, you need to make sure you choose the right plan. You can do one of these things:
Work with a Real Estate Agent
Working with an experienced real estate agent in Minneapolis can speed up the process by a lot. Agents know the local market, can help you set a fair price, and use tried-and-true marketing methods to get people to buy quickly. Find real estate professionals in your area who have a good track record.
Sell Your House Yourself (FSBO)
For Sale by Owner (FSBO) is a way to sell your home without paying a real estate agent. You have more control with this choice, but it might take longer since you won’t have access to marketing and professional networks. You will need to be able to handle showings, negotiations, and papers by yourself.
Consider Cash Buyers or iBuyer Programs
For the fastest sale, you might want to sell to someone who pays cash or use an iBuyer program. With these choices, you have no obligation cash offer can often skip repairs, inspections, and the usual closure dates. Do not forget that deals might be less than the market value.
Target a Quick Sale with Strategic Pricing
If you price your home a little below what it’s worth on the market, you may get more offers faster. A Comparative Market Analysis (CMA) can help you set a price that will make people want to buy your home.

Step 5: Navigating the Selling Process
Selling your house fast in Minneapolis, you need to know the right steps to take to make the process go more smoothly and get serious buyers. Know this:
Receiving Offers
When the market is competitive, offers can come in quickly after your home is put on the market. Carefully consider each offer cash or deal, taking into account:
Price: Is it close to or more than what you want for it?
Possible outcomes: Check for things that could cause the closing to be delayed, like inspections or funding.
Timeline: If closing fees and speed is important to you, look for buyers whose closing dates are open or quick.
Negotiating Terms & No Obligation Offer
If you want to sell your house quickly, you need to be able to negotiate. Together with your real estate agent, do the following:
Plan your counteroffer to get the best deal.
Make sure the buyer has options for when they can move out, do inspections, and get funding.
Find words that work for everyone and keep the process going.
Handling Inspections, Appraisals and Fair Cash Offer
A home inspection is often asked for by buyers. Some common problems in Minneapolis are:
Make sure that the HVAC and heater systems are in good shape.
Concerns about the foundation and water: Take care of any flooding or basement problems right away.
Prepare your home ahead of time to avoid delays. If the evaluation or all cash offer is low, you might want to work with your agent to renegotiate or look into other options for the buyer.
Step 6: Closing the Sale – Selling My House Fast in Minneapolis, MN
The last and most important step in selling your Minneapolis, MN home quickly is closing the deal. For an easy process, here’s what you need to know:
Understand the Closing Process & Closing Costs
When you accept an offer, the closing process usually takes between 30 and 45 days.
The buyer’s final inspection, the title search, and getting the closing papers ready are all important steps.
- To stay on track, work with your real estate advisor and a nearby title company.
- Prepare for Seller Closing Costs
- In Minneapolis, common selling costs are:
- Five to six percent of the sale price goes to the real estate agent.
- Fees to move title
- Splitting up property taxes
- Possible closing costs or fix credits
- Plan for these prices so you don’t get caught off guard.
What to Expect on Closing Day
- Bring your ID, the keys, and any other paperwork the title company asks for.
- Read and sign all the forms that you need to, including the deed transfer.
- After everything is done, you’ll get your money through a wire transfer or a check.
Finalize Your Move
- Set a date to move out before the end.
- Leave the house clean and take all of your things with you.
- Turn off the utilities or give them to the new owner.
